The degrees of freedom of multiway junctions in three dimensional gravity

Abstract

We demonstrate that nn-way junctions in three dimensional gravity correspond to coupled n1n-1 strings each satisfying the Nambu-Goto equation in the smoothened background, and with sources consisting of Monge-Amp\`{e}re like terms which couple the strings. For n3n\geq 3, these n1n-1 degrees of freedom survive the tensionless limit implying that matter-like behavior can arise out of \textit{pure} gravity. We interpret these stringy degrees of freedom of gravitational junctions holographically in terms of wavepackets which collectively undergo perfect reflection at the multi-interface in the dual conformal field theory.
